I noticed that under GIFTS that you can purchase a waffle terry bathrobe to be delivered onboard.  I want to wait to purchase this onboard (so I can use my onboard credit).  Is this possible?  If so how do I go about it (where and when to order it).

We purchased our bathrobes (that we were able to monogram since we ordered them earlier enough in the cruise) when we were in a Neptune suite. We just asked the Neptune lounge concierge to order. It was pre-Covid and we received the Mariner discount on the cost. 

 

On the Rotterdam trip I just returned from (in a balcony cabin), I wanted to purchase one of the new orange and blue blankets included in the cabin. I went to guest services and requested to purchase it and it was in my cabin the next day, and charged to my room using OBC. For anyone interested, the blanket was $35 charged as “sale of general supplies” with no HAL merchandise Mariner discount.   Easy peasy and I love the blanket!

Last spring on our  Panama Canal cruise on the Zaandam I was overflowing with ship board credit.  I went to guest services and purchased one...I think it was around $50.  It was delivered to my stateroom.  I got the basic one with blue trim....warning, it weighs a lot so consider that if you are flying.  Since we drove to the port weight didn't  matter.  I love my robe and wear. it more now than I ever did in our stateroom!

 

On the Eurodam last month I mentioned at guest services how much I liked the robe....they said they didn't have any to sell on board this time.

We bought one for my wife and my mother in law a while back. My mother in law liked the waffle version while the heavier Neptune Suite terry cloth was preferred by @Huskerchick

 

We ordered them at the beginning of the voyage so there was time to monogram them. There used to be a discount coupon in the rooms for a few years, but that may be in the past. I think you saved $5 or so with the coupon.

 

You had a standard robe during the cruise and your purchased robe was delivered later. That way you were taking a brand new robe home. DW still has hers and uses it regularly. It's probably 15 years old and it has held up well.
